如何將 R 中的資料框匯出到 Excel 中?


可以用 xlsx 包的 write.xlsx 函式將 R 中的資料框匯出到 excel 中。我們需要傳入資料框名、檔名和我們要在其中儲存資料框的 sheet 名。例如,如果我們有一個名為 df 的資料框,檔名為 Excel_df,並且在 sheet1 中,那麼可以使用以下命令儲存資料框 −

write.xlsx(df, file="Excel_df.xlsx", sheetName = "Sheet1")

考慮以下資料框 −

示例

 現場演示

x<-rnorm(20)
y<-rnorm(20)
z<-rnorm(20)
df<-data.frame(x,y,z)
df

輸出

        x         y           z
1   0.04319856   1.6785739    1.77106752
2  -0.36870535  -0.5876720   -0.13563273
3  -1.11985900  -1.1756613    0.99374670
4   0.07497696  -0.1004814    0.59998832
5   0.47198699  -0.9880506    0.56023277
6  -0.40857098   0.4455695   -1.01059422
7   0.19381445  -1.0285333    1.35449579
8  -1.56931369   0.3467661    0.09928035
9   0.01467629  -0.9501424   -0.27383159
10 -0.70354093  -1.2913159   -0.26957811
11  0.13393603   0.2261357   -0.26161987
12  1.26584454   1.4669579    0.23035925
13  1.24692292   0.8695646   -0.94605061
14  0.73639868   1.3668048   -0.91025497
15 -1.59570185  -1.8947813    2.01405239
16  1.97949873   0.8275024    0.10388833
17  0.28805664   1.4392612    1.91595195
18  0.26419780   1.0322670    0.04117154
19 -0.19036166  -0.1917548   -1.41957429
20  0.20173227   1.4283021    0.25179883

載入 xlsx 包並將資料框 df 匯出到 Excel 中 −

示例

library("xlsx")
write.xlsx(df, file="ExcelExport.xlsx", sheetName = "Sheet1")

輸出

更新於: 10-2-2021

567 瀏覽量

開啟你的 職業生涯

透過完成課程獲得認證

入門
廣告
© . All rights reserved.